About us

Hartnell Chanot & Partners are pioneers of Mediation, Counselling and Collaborative Law and have established themselves as the largest Family Law Solicitors in the South West. Based in Exeter, we only handle family law and are dedicated to providing expert advice in all aspects of divorce and separation including:

  • Children
  • Finances
  • Unmarried Couples
  • Domestic Violence
  • Care Proceedings
  • Child Protection
  • Child Abduction
  • Adoption
  • Civil Partnerships
  • Counselling
  • Family Mediation

We offer new clients free initial advice and eligible clients legal aid.
